Ontario government to spend $750M on STEM programs at colleges, universities

  • Ontario invested $750 million in STEM programs at colleges and universities on April 22, 2025.
  • Institutions faced financial struggles due to frozen tuition and capped international students.
  • The funding expands training capacity and connects students to jobs.
  • Minister Nolan Quinn states the funding creates 20,500 annual spots.
  • The investment aims to strengthen the economy against uncertainty.

Ontario to spend $750 million on STEM programs at universities, colleges

Ontario says it will invest $750 million to boost funding for science, technology, engineering and mathematics programs at colleges and universities across the province.
